I am using a Mac Mini and have the OWC external Blu-ray drive. I've successfully ripped several Blu-rays so far, but for some reason the original Terminator will not copy. It reads the disc, allows me to select which tracks I want, then it will copy the disk to my drive. At the end of the copy, however, I will get this error and it will say "1 titles copied, 0 titles saved"
Saving 1 titles into directory /Users/MacMiniHTPC/Desktop/convert
Error 'Posix error - Input/output error' occurred while reading '/BDMV/STREAM/00017.m2ts' at offset '13212186624'
Error 'Posix error - Input/output error' occurred while reading '/BDMV/STREAM/00017.m2ts' at offset '13212186624'
Failed to save title 2 to file /Users/MacMiniHTPC/Desktop/convert/title02.mkv
0 titles saved, 1 failed
Saving 1 titles into directory /Users/MacMiniHTPC/Desktop/convert
Error 'Posix error - Input/output error' occurred while reading '/BDMV/STREAM/00017.m2ts' at offset '13202159616'
Error 'Posix error - Input/output error' occurred while reading '/BDMV/STREAM/00017.m2ts' at offset '13202159616'
Failed to save title 2 to file /Users/MacMiniHTPC/Desktop/convert/title02.mkv
0 titles saved, 1 failed
That was on two attempts. Something to do with an i/o error at a specific stream? Does anyone know what that means and how to remedy this?

This looks like a bad disc or drive. Unless you install DASPI driver, MakeMKV can't get any better error code from OS.
